App Description

Most apps try to motivate you. Monad forces you to think.

Monad is a structured reasoning tool for those who feel adrift. It rejects gamification and inspirational language in favor of clinical analysis, hard constraints, and value alignment.

CORE MODULES:

BASELINE: Free-form intake to extract sources of drain and avoided decisions.

VALUES: Forced-choice extraction to define your 5–7 non-negotiable principles.

CONSTRAINTS: Map your hard limits in money, time, and energy.

DIRECTION: Define a single 6–12 month trajectory. No multiple goals; one path.

DECISION TOOL: Analyze options based on cost, reversibility, and alignment.

DRIFT DETECTION: Weekly logs that plainly flag actions contradicting your values.

PRINCIPLES:

Neutral UI: No emojis, no rewards, no streaks.

Privacy-First: Local storage by default. No data selling.

Reasoning-First: Text-heavy, analytical interface.

Stop seeking motivation. Start mapping your constraints.
